Legal use of the signed Word document
eSigned Word documents are legally recognized in the United States, provided they comply with the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ce (ESIGN) Act and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A). This means that as long as all parties agree to use electronic signatures, the signed document holds the same legal weight as a traditional paper document. It is essential to ensure that the eSignature process is secure and verifiable to maintain the document's integrity.
